ROOKIE FORWARD DALTON KNECHT SIDELINED — PLACED ON INJURY LIST AFTER PRACTICE SETBACK

   

The Los Angeles Lakers have suffered a tough blow to their promising rookie class as forward Dalton Knecht has officially been placed on the injury list following a practice setback. Just weeks into his first NBA offseason, Knecht’s momentum hits a pause as the team monitors his recovery timeline.

Knecht, the 17th overall pick in the 2024 NBA Draft, had been turning heads during early workouts and was expected to compete for meaningful minutes in the upcoming season. Known for his scoring ability and perimeter shooting, the 6’6” wing had already become a fan favorite thanks to his confident play and mature mindset.

According to sources, the injury occurred during a team scrimmage earlier this week. While initial assessments suggest it’s not a long-term concern, the Lakers are taking a cautious approach, prioritizing long-term health over short-term participation. The franchise has not released the exact nature of the injury, but insiders indicate it could sideline him for multiple weeks, potentially missing valuable preseason training sessions.

Lakers head coach Darvin Ham shared, “Dalton’s been working his tail off. He’s got the right attitude, and we’re confident he’ll bounce back strong. We’re just being smart with his development.”

Fans and analysts alike are hopeful this setback doesn’t derail Knecht’s chances of contributing early in the season. His ability to stretch the floor and play with high energy made him a standout at Tennessee and during pre-draft workouts.

With training camp in full swing, all eyes will now turn to how the Lakers adjust their rotation and how Knecht responds during his recovery. In a season with championship aspirations, every player counts—and L.A. knows the value of developing its young talent the right way.
